Sealing

Window seals, also known as upvc window repairs near me window seals, play crucial roles in the insulation of double-glazed windows. Incorrect seals can cause drafts, condensation and other problems. Fortunately, damaged seals can be replaced or repaired to restore the effectiveness of your double glazing.

The most obvious sign that your double glazed windows need to be resealed is water leaking between the glass panes. This moisture can damage the frames of your windows and increase the cost of energy. The condensation between glass can cause a foggy look that can come and go dependent on the temperature of the outside or indoor humidity levels.

If you believe that the seals on your double-glazed windows aren't working, it's recommended to contact the installer. They'll be able to visit your home and repair the affected area, which is usually less expensive than replacing the entire window unit. Also, you should check your warranty paperwork as the company who installed your double-glazed windows could still be covered by warranty, saving you money on repairs or replacements.

A double-glazed window repair technician will use various tools to fix your broken windows, including gasket rollers that assist in helping to push the new seals into place. These tools can make it easier to get an airtight seal, which is vital for your windows' efficiency.

A defective seal between the glass panes of double-glazed window can cause a myriad of issues. These include moisture between the panes of the window and inefficiency of the energy system, and distortion of the view. In the majority of cases, a window seal replacement is the process of removing the old glass and replacing it with. This can be accomplished without having to replace the frame of the window.

It is important to note that you should consult an expert to repair or replace your double-glazed window seals since it's generally more time-consuming and difficult than attempting the task yourself. Also, it's recommended to choose a double-glazing repair company that is certified and registered since this will give you peace of mind that they'll complete the job right.

Glass

Double-glazed windows consist of two panes with an airspace between them. The air is filled with gases like argon and krypton that reduce the heat transfer through your windows. This allows you to keep your home at a pleasant temperature without putting too much strain on your cooling and heating system. It is essential to repair your double-glazed window as soon as it becomes cracked or broken.

Typically, replacing the glass in your double glazed window will be the best method to repair it. It is important to understand that repairing double-paned windows involves more than just replacing the glass. It also involves fixing the seal that was installed by the factory to ensure that your window functions as it should. This is why it's usually recommended to hire a professional for your double glazing repairs instead of trying to do it yourself.

Double glazing can last for years when maintained properly, but there are issues that can occur. These problems can reduce the effectiveness of double-glazed windows and doors as well as make them look unattractive. Luckily, there are many ways these issues can be solved at an affordable cost, so you don't have to change your windows entirely.

Misting is a frequent issue when it comes to double-glazed windows. This happens when the seal around the glass panel fails, allowing moisture-laden air to be able to get into the panes of glass. This can cause windows to become cloudy, or even wet. This also reduces the insulation of double-glazed windows.

This kind of issue is painful because it can cause significant damage to the appearance and performance of your double-glazed windows. To avoid this issue, you should contact the company from which you purchased your double-glazed windows as soon as possible to report the issue. The issue should be reported in writing. This is done via either email or telephone. This will enable you to keep a record of your conversations, any agreements reached and the date that the problem will be solved.

Frames

If the frame of your double glazing is damaged, it will need to be repaired. This can be due to a variety of factors such as weather conditions or wear and wear and tear. In most cases, the frames can be repaired, but in certain cases, they might require replacement.

While it's tempting to attempt and fix some of the issues yourself, it's suggested to engage a professional to do the work for you. Having a trusted and experienced professional take care of the repairs will ensure that they are completed safely and in a safe manner. It's important to act quickly in the event of any issues with double-glazed windows. This will avoid further damage and will keep your home secure and warm. By making sure that your windows are as efficient as possible you will save money on energy bills.

One of the most common problems faced by double-glazing owners is that their windows and doors are difficult to open or close. This can be due to various reasons, such as extreme temperatures or dirt buildup. This problem can usually be fixed by a double glazing repair service.

Another issue that is common is misting between the panes of glass. The seals are often responsible for misting. It is possible to fix the issue with a double glazing repair, but they can sometimes require replacement. This will help to reduce condensation and prevent draughts from becoming.

Finally, many people have reported that their double glazed window repairs near me-glazed has become saggy or even dropped. This can be due to various factors, such as extreme weather conditions or damage caused by falling objects. It's worth trying to contact the person who installed your windows as soon as you notice an issue, and remember to follow up in writing.

Double glazing is a great investment for your home. It is essential that any issues are addressed as soon as possible. This will help you save money on energy bills and ensure that your double-glazed windows are operating as efficiently as they can.

Hardware

Double-glazed windows can face various issues over time. These include problems with the seals, water ingress, and foggy glass. Many people believe they need to replace their entire window when these issues arise. However, many of them can easily be repaired.

To repair a double glazed window repairs near me the first step is to remove the pane from the frame. This must be done with care to avoid further damage to the glass. Next, remove any paint or sealants around the edges of your glass. You can use a putty blade or a scraper to remove the sealant. Once the old pane is removed, the new pane can be placed into the frame. A fresh layer of sealant needs to be applied.

If the window is covered by warranty, you might be able to request that the manufacturer replace the glass unit free of charge. If not, it's worth getting a professional to inspect the window and make any repairs required.

The hardware is equally important as the glass in windows that are double-glazed. This includes the sash as well as balance which are used to open and close the window. If these parts are damaged, it could be difficult to use the window and could cause safety hazards. If the balance or sash are damaged, it's recommended to consult a double glazing specialist for repair services.

Condensation between the panes is a different issue with double-glazed windows. This occurs when warm air comes in contact with cooler window repairs panes. While this is a natural process however, it can result in water infiltration and the rotting process. Installing a ventilator in your house is the best way to avoid this.

If you own a listed property, it is important to choose a double glazed company that has expertise working with historical properties. In many cases, it is possible to install slim profile double glazed units in listed structures without compromising the style of the property. These options can be made to look like windows of the past and will keep the house warm while retaining its historical style.
